Effectiveness of IPL for Different Skin Types

IPL works by delivering high-intensity light pulses to the skin, targeting specific pigments or blood vessels. The light energy is absorbed by the target area, leading to the destruction of unwanted pigments or vessels. While IPL can be effective for a wide range of skin concerns, its efficacy can vary based on the individual’s skin type.

Normal Skin: IPL is generally very effective for individuals with normal skin types. It can help improve skin tone, reduce pigmentation, and minimize the appearance of fine lines.

Dry Skin: People with dry skin may experience some sensitivity during IPL treatment. It is essential to hydrate the skin adequately before and after the procedure to minimize any potential side effects.

Oily Skin: IPL can be beneficial for individuals with oily skin as it can help reduce excess oil production and improve the appearance of acne scars and blemishes.

Combination Skin: IPL can work well for individuals with combination skin by targeting specific areas of concern such as pigmentation or redness.

Sensitive Skin: People with sensitive skin may experience some discomfort during IPL treatment. It is crucial to communicate any sensitivities or allergies to your skincare provider before undergoing the procedure.

Mature Skin: IPL can be highly effective for individuals with mature skin as it can help stimulate collagen production, leading to smoother and firmer skin.

Factors Affecting IPL Efficacy

Several factors can influence the effectiveness of IPL for different skin types. These include the individual’s skin tone, the severity of the skin concern being targeted, the expertise of the skincare provider, and the number of treatment sessions required.

Ultimately, the success of IPL treatment for different skin types depends on a combination of these factors. It is essential to consult with a qualified skincare professional to determine if IPL is the right treatment option for your specific skin concerns.

FAQs

Q: Is IPL suitable for all skin types?
A: IPL can be effective for various skin types, but it is essential to consult with a skincare professional to assess your suitability for the treatment.

Q: How many IPL sessions are typically required for optimal results?
A: The number of IPL sessions required can vary depending on the individual’s skin concerns and goals. Most people require multiple sessions spaced several weeks apart for optimal results.

Q: Are there any side effects associated with IPL treatment?
A: Some common side effects of IPL treatment include redness, swelling, and mild discomfort. These side effects are usually temporary and subside within a few days.
